PARIS (Reuters) - Here are some of the key points in the programme of Francois Fillon, the conservative Republicans candidate for France's presidential election on April 23 and May 7.
The former prime minister proposes a supply-side economic strategy with cuts in public spending, loosening restrictions on the length of the working week, and raising the retirement age.
